The statement that best explains the impact the creation of Israel has had on the Middle East is:

**The creation of Israel provided a homeland for the Jews, but it also led to military conflict, the rise of terrorism, and the Palestinian refugee crisis.**

This statement captures the dual nature of the creation of Israel, acknowledging both the establishment of a Jewish homeland and the resulting tensions and conflicts that have arisen in the region.
